Understanding the Impact of Severe Hemolysis on Kidneys

Severe hemolysis significantly strains the kidneys as they filter excess hemoglobin from the blood. This breakdown can lead to hemoglobinuria, risking renal tubule damage. Recognizing these effects underscores the importance of early intervention to maintain kidney function and prevent acute injury.

The Kidneys Take the Heat

Now, hold onto your hats because here’s the kicker: the kidneys are the primary organ affected during severe hemolysis. Why? Because they operate as the body’s filtration system. When hemoglobin spills into the bloodstream, the kidneys need to work harder than ever to excrete this excess.

You see, kidneys are pretty remarkable—they filter out waste and reabsorb substances the body still needs. But when faced with the onslaught of free hemoglobin, they can get overwhelmed faster than a barista on a Monday morning. Manifesting as hemoglobinuria, the presence of hemoglobin in urine may sound harmless; chances are, it’s anything but.

This excess can cause damage to renal tubules, which are essential for your kidneys to function optimally. If this situation spirals out of control, it can evolve into acute kidney injury (AKI)—a sudden decline of kidney function that, honestly, nobody wants to experience.

Detection and Prevention

Here’s where healthcare professionals swing into action. Diagnosing hemolysis typically involves blood tests that check the levels of hemoglobin and other blood components. But ultimately, it’s your awareness of your body that can make a world of difference. If you feel something’s off in terms of energy levels or physical well-being, don’t hesitate to consult your doctor.

Preventing risks for hemolysis can be a multifaceted approach. Managing chronic conditions, avoiding toxic substances, and keeping up with vaccinations can all play a part. Remember, our kidneys are integral to the overall health of our bodies, and we should treat them with the care they deserve.
